Borers

Borers - belong to the order Lepidoptera, family Cossidae. The most important species include the goat moth (Cossus cossus) and the leopard moth (Zeuzera pyrina). The goat moth is a polyphagous species, attacking the trunk and thicker branches of various species of forest trees and fruit trees. The leopard moth is a widespread species in Europe, America etc. It is a polyphagous species, common on various species of fruit trees, ornamental, and forest trees.
